Delmar A. Feldmann, 74, of Epworth, Iowa, passed away Sunday, January 29, 2017 at his home surrounded by his family in Epworth, Iowa.
Friends and relatives of Delmar may call from 5 to 7 p.m., Thursday, February 2, 2017 at the Reiff Funeral Home in Epworth, Iowa. Military Honors will be afforded by the Epworth American Legion-John White Post #650 at 6:30 p.m. A celebration of life will follow the services at Funnigans in Epworth, IA.
Delmar was born May 2, 1942 in Monticello, Iowa, son of Charles and Irene (Kelchen) Feldmann. He graduated in 1956 from St. Paul's High school in Worthington, IA. On October 19, 1963 he was united in marriage to Mary Lou Loeffelholz at St. Francis Xavier in Dyersville, Iowa.
Delmar was a U.S. Army Veteran. He was a member of the Epworth American Legion-John White Post #650.
He was a loving husband, father, grandfather and great grandfather who always enjoyed playing Euchre.
